Abstract

Background: Third molar surgery is associated with various postoperative complications (PC). Different strategies, including the application of platelet-rich fibrin (PRF), have been implemented to reduce PC. Digital technologies have proven useful in objectively assessing postoperative facial swelling. This study aimed to evaluate the effect of PRF on reducing facial swelling after lower third molar surgery using a 3D face scanner.

Methods: A randomized split-mouth clinical trial was set up and 32 patients (18 to 32 years), requiring extraction of both mandibular third molars, were recruited at the Oral Surgery Clinic of the Magna Graecia University of Catanzaro. The primary predictive variable was the application or not of PRF plugs and membranes in the post-extraction socket. Primary outcome variable was facial swelling recorded with a face scanner preoperatively (T0), after three (T1) and seven (T2) days. Qualitative and quantitative data analysis were conducted following an automated and standardized imaging analysis workflow using the 3D Slicer software. Secondary outcome variables were trismus, recorded by measuring the maximum buccal opening with a caliper, pain, recorded using a visual analogue scale (VAS), and duration of the surgery. Descriptive and bivariate analysis were performed by setting the significance level [Formula: see text] = 0.05.

Results: All patients exhibited a significant increase in facial swelling at T1, followed by a subsequent reduction from day 3 to day 7, with a slight persistence of edema observed on the seventh day. No significant data emerged from the statistical analysis conducted. Linear differences in PRF group reported improved values of postoperative swelling only in the T1-T2 and T0-T2 phases of analysis. Volumetric differences favored PRF group compared with control group in all phases. VAS was lower in PRF group only at T2, compared with control group.

Conclusions: Application of PRF in post-extraction sockets showed effectiveness in reducing facial swelling. Its advantages, including accessibility, cost-effectiveness, and absence of adverse reactions, make it an optimal treatment choice in reducing post-surgical sequelae.

期刊介绍: Head & Face Medicine is a multidisciplinary open access journal that publishes basic and clinical research concerning all aspects of cranial, facial and oral conditions. The journal covers all aspects of cranial, facial and oral diseases and their management. It has been designed as a multidisciplinary journal for clinicians and researchers involved in the diagnostic and therapeutic aspects of diseases which affect the human head and face. The journal is wide-ranging, covering the development, aetiology, epidemiology and therapy of head and face diseases to the basic science that underlies these diseases. Management of head and face diseases includes all aspects of surgical and non-surgical treatments including psychopharmacological therapies.
